I just cleaned my guinea pig, Sophie's cage. When I was done and took her out of the carrier I noticed some brown liquid, almost as if diarrhea. There were other poop pellets in there but they were firm. I'm a little worried so any help would be awesome! :o
 
Is there anyway you could post a photo? Check her bottom and see if it is wet or soiled.
 
Does it smell?

Have you checked the carrier for urine? It could just be that Sophie has weed on her poo pile so what you are describing could just be urine.

Watery diarrhea usually smells bad and can be serious but I wouldn't have thought there would be normal poos too and I would imagine Sophie to look poorly.

Normal diarrhea has a paste like consistency a bit like tooth paste.
